  • Richard HaseltineRichard Haseltine Posts: 102,418

    Looking at your screenshots again, the shader presets don't have the type tag - the word Shader at top-right - which suggests they are simply not in the database at all. The shaders are in the Default resources package try (re)installing that, with DIM or with Connect inside DS.

    Most people do not see the shaders in the Surfaces Tab and spend hours trying to figure out if they have this and that installed when the issue is often ultra simple :

    Use the Surface selection tool (Alt+Shift+M). Instead of selecting an object in the viewport, now you can select a surface. 

    And suddenly, the default shaders and any extra shaders you eventually bought on the store, are there in The Surface / Presets Tab.
